Real Madrid star Jude Bellingham wanted to play for a rival club when he was younger.

The midfielder is now established as one of the standout players in world football and won the Champions League and LaLiga during his first season with Real.

However, Bellingham’s primary school leavers yearbook entry has emerged and reveals that the 20-year-old previously dreamed of playing for a different team. 

Bellingham started his career at Birmingham City before joining Borussia Dortmund and then signing for Real.

He attended Priory School in Edgbaston, Birmingham.

When he was younger Bellingham actually wanted to play for Real Madrid’s rivals Barcelona. 

In pictures posted on TikTok by one of his former classmates, underneath a header saying: ‘When I grow up I want to be’, Bellingham wrote:  ‘When I grow up I want to be a professional footballer for Barcelona and England.’

Bellingham’s ultimate dream was to have a football tour with David Beckham and he added that Adam Sandler movies were the thing that made him laugh.

Having already made 29 appearances for England, Bellingham is set to be a key player for the Three Lions at Euro 2024 and he will be determined to make a major impact.

Bellingham didn’t feature in England’s warm-up games against Bosnia and Herzegovina and Iceland after being given time off following Real’s Champions League success.
